]2eDeYe Posted June 18, 2010 Report Share Posted June 18, 2010 Depends on the parts. Most mechanical stuff you can still get at the parts store. Body parts and interior stuff is a little harder to come by unless you want used stuff. Link to comment

datsunaholic Posted June 19, 2010 Report Share Posted June 19, 2010 Unless you're completely missing the seat, it's best to just get what you have restuffed and recovered. As for the metal, you can get them "new" but they are garbage quality out of China, and cost a fortune in shipping. Link to comment
